Ingredients requirements Our Family's Favorite "Stranger" Rice Bowl:

  1. Require 1 medium Onion.
  2. Need 150 grams - Pork or beef.
  3. Give 1 tbsp for Mirin.
  4. Prepare 1 tbsp Katakuriko.
  5. You need 120 ml of Dashi stock.
  6. You need 2 tbsp of Soy sauce.
  7. Give 2 tbsp for Mirin.
  8. Need 1 tbsp for Sake.
  9. Provide 2 tubs Eggs.
  10. Need 1 of Mitsuba, shiso leaves, green onion etc..
  11. Give 1 large of Umeboshi (to taste).





Our Family's Favorite "Stranger" Rice Bowl making process:

  1. Cut the pork into bite-sized pieces and sprinkle with the mirin. Coat with katakuriko. Slice the onion to about 5 mm thick..
  2. Put a little bit of dashi stock in a frying pan, and stir fry the onion until it changes color..
  3. Add the meat and stir fry until it just starts to change color..
  4. Add the rest of the dashi stock and skim off the scum. Add the soy sauce, mirin and sake and simmer for 3 to 4 minutes..
  5. Add the beaten egg, turn down the heat to low and put on a lid..
  6. Once the egg is soft set, turn off the heat. Add some roughly chopped mitsuba and put the lid back on for a minute to steam..
  7. Finished. Add an umeboshi plum to taste..
